Bulgari Hotel, Beijing is located in the commercial area of Beijing, 25 km from Beijing Capital International airport, and provides an indoor swimming pool. The hotel also offers a currency exchange and a lift and parking on site.
Location
This Beijing property is situated in the very heart of Chaoyang, holding a vast variety of attractions and leisure options for all tastes and features easy access to Yansha Youyi Shangcheng, which is a mere 0.6 km away. Yansha Youyi Shopping Mall is around 5 minutes' walk from the Bulgari Hotel, Beijing, while Anjialou bus stop is merely a 10-minute walk away. The accommodation is located in a garden. Forbidden City-The Palace Museum is around 7 km away, while Liangmaqiao is within sight of the 5-star Bulgari Hotel, Beijing.
The nearest underground station is just 5 minutes' walk away.
Rooms
There are 119 luminous rooms at this property, some of them have soundproof windows, and modern facilities such as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. They are furnished with custom-made furniture featuring a wardrobe and a sofa. A rainfall shower and a hot tub, along with such comforts as hairdryers and dressing gowns, are also provided. Aside from that, premium views of the river are featured.
Eat & Drink
Guests can have breakfast in the restaurant every morning. There is a private lounge bar for you to have a drink. It also looks onto the garden. This Beijing hotel is only 550 metres from Il Ristorante Niko Romito, that serves Italian cuisine.
Leisure & Business
The Bulgari Hotel, features a sauna, a lending library, and a garden, as well as a gym and a fitness club located on-site. The accommodation has a health centre and a spa lounge featuring a Turkish steam bath, a Turkish steam room, and an indoor pool.
